Full disclosure: I have been HIV positive for almost 13 years now.
I am sick and tired of the head of the AIDS Healthcare Foundation spending its resources trying to force the porn industry to incorporate condom usage. From 1998 to 2009, a total of 35 porn industry performers have tested positive for HIV. (And surely some, if not most, of those people were infected off set.) I don't want to diminish the enormity of what those 35 people now have to deal with for the rest of their lives, but consider for a moment that during the time that three dozen porn performers were infected with HIV, literally MILLIONS of people around the world were infected with HIV, largely through poor decision making in the heat of passion in the privacy of their own bedrooms.
In going after the porn industry, the head of the AIDS Healthcare Foundation fights a losing battle. If California forces the studios to incorporate condoms, the studios will simply pick up and move to another state. And if all the other states follow suit, the porn studios will simply move overseas.
The really sickening thing here is that in a time when non-profits are struggling financially and when people with HIV/AIDS need the most help, the head of the AIDS Healthcare Foundation is busy squandering his organization's funds simply to make a point.
I think you are missing the point. The issue is much more nuanced than what you have outlined. Even if "only" 35 porn stars have been infected with HIV, the bigger question is how many people have been infected as a result and how many people were infected by those people. So, to play the numbers game on the conservative side is being a little less than honest, don't you think?
The bigger point is that men and women who watch porn often imitate what they see. It has taught them a lot about sex (for better or worse). Don't you think it would be helpful to get that generation of young people who are being sexually adventurous to develop a culture of condom use?
I also find your excuse of not doing it because the industry will move to another state and then to another state and then out of the US somewhat one-dimensional. The same argument was made when discussing whether or not to put airbags in cars back in the 1970's. At that time opponents said it would cost too much, it wouldn't save that many more lives, cars would be too expensive and then car manufacturers would have to shut down. None of those things happened. It was the right thing to do then because it saved lives.
And so do condoms (obviously not in automobile accidents unless you are very, and I mean very lucky). :-)
As to fighting the HIV battle around the world, you are absolutely right. More needs to be done, we need to educate the men and women in the third world.
